Industrial building energy consumption is a major contributor to global emissions. To mitigate this impact, a multi-faceted approach is required. Implementing sustainable design check here principles during the construction phase can significantly reduce future energy demands. Upgrading existing buildings with technologies like smart thermostats can also yield substantial efficiency improvements. Additionally, promoting green initiatives such as solar power and wind energy can further decrease the reliance on fossil fuels. A concerted effort from building owners, developers, policymakers, and tenants is essential to achieve meaningful and lasting reductions in commercial building energy emissions.

Legislative Solutions for Decarbonizing the Commercial Energy Sector

Transitioning the commercial energy sector away from fossil fuels is critical to achieving global decarbonization goals. Effective regulations are needed to encourage the adoption of clean energy sources and reduce reliance on conventional energy systems.

Governments can implement a range of tools to drive this transition. These include carbon pricing mechanisms, such as cap-and-trade systems, which leverage a financial cost on polluting activities.

Furthermore, financial subsidies can be provided to businesses that deploy renewable energy technologies. Streamlining permitting processes can also make it easier for commercial entities to integrate sustainable energy solutions.

  • Promoting research and development of new energy technologies is essential for driving innovation and reducing costs.
  • Increasing understanding about the benefits of decarbonization can influence behavior towards sustainable practices.

Ultimately, a comprehensive and integrated approach that utilizes a variety of policy solutions is necessary to effectively decarbonize the commercial energy sector.
